Kirchhoff’s law:
- Let E be the total emissive power of the body and α be the absorptivity of the body.
- Emissivity (ϵ) is the ratio of the emissive power of a non-black body to the black body.
- ϵ = \(\frac{E}{E_b}\)
- Kirchhoff’s law also holds for monochromatic radiation, for which
- \(\frac{{{E_{\lambda 1}}}}{{{\alpha _{\lambda 1}}}} = \frac{{{E_{\lambda 2}}}}{{{\alpha _{\lambda 2}}}} = \frac{{{E_{b\lambda }}}}{{{\alpha _{b\lambda }}}} = \frac{{{E_{b\lambda }}}}{1}\)
- ∵ The absorptivity of a black body is one.
- \(\therefore \frac{{{E_\lambda }}}{{{\alpha _\lambda }}} = {E_{b\lambda }} \Rightarrow {\alpha _\lambda } = \frac{{{E_\lambda }}}{{{E_{b\lambda }}}} = {\epsilon_\lambda }\)
- Therefore, the monochromatic emissivity of a black body is equal to the monochromatic absorptivity at the same wavelength.
- Eλ = αλEbλ
- According to Kirchhoff’s law, the ratio of total emissive power to absorptivity is constant for all bodies which are in thermal equilibrium with the surroundings. Therefore, it means that the emissivity of a body is equal to its absorptivity.
Stefan-Boltzmann Law
- The thermal energy radiated by a black body per second per unit area is proportional to the fourth power of the absolute temperature and is given by:
- E ∝ T4
- E = σT4
- σ = The Stefan – Boltzmann constant = 5.67 × 10-8 Wm-2K-4
Wien’s displacement law
- For a black body emissive spectrum, the wavelength λmax giving the maximum emissive power at a temperature is inversely proportional to the absolute temperature.
- λmax = \(\frac{c}{T}\)
- λmaxT= c
